Wyoming Agent Solutions Overview Agent services in Wyoming play a vital role for businesses operating in the state. A registered agent is an person or entity appointed to receive crucial legal documents, including service of process, government correspondence, and compliance notifications. This service not just ensures that businesses adhere with Wyoming law, but also offers a level of confidentiality, as personal addresses are kept private. In Wyoming, the criteria for a registered agent are straightforward. The agent must have a real address in the state and be on hand during standard business hours to receive documents. Compliance and Reporting with a Designated Agent Using a designated agent in the state of Wyoming significantly simplifies adherence and reporting obligations for companies. One key function of a designated agent is to ensure that your company remains in compliance with state laws by accepting crucial legal documents and notices. This entails service of process documents, which are essential for informing a business of legal actions against it. By having a trustworthy representative, you reduce the risk of missing critical communications that could lead to penalties or even lawsuits. Additionally, registered agents can assist with the annual report submission in the state of Wyoming, which is a required requirement for maintaining good standing. These reports outline essential information about your company and must be filed on time to prevent late fees or administrative dissolution.
